Research on the Effect of Fractionated Irradiation with Variable Fraction Sizes on the Mice Bearing SK-BR-3 Tumor |

Abstract Objective To analyze the effect of fractionated irradiation with variable fraction sizes (VFS) on the mice bearing SK-BR-3 tumor.Methods The mice were divided into six groups, four groups were irradiated with different VFS protocols, one group was irradiated with constant fraction size (CFS) protocol, one group was non-irradiated as a comparing group.For these groups of mice, the average surviving period (ASP) and the change of tumor volume were observed and compared.Results The ASP of irradiated groups are all longer than that of non-irradiated group, and the difference of ASP between these groups have the statistical significance respectively.Also the ASP of the groups irradiated with VFS protocols are all longer than that of the group irradiated with CFS protocol, but the difference is of no statistical significance.For the mice irradiated with decreasing fraction sizes, the ASP is longer than that of the mice irradiated with corresponding increasing fraction sizes, but the difference has no statistical significance.For these six groups, the tumor volumes are all increasing in this experiment, and the increasing speed of non-irradiated group is faster than that of all the other irradiated groups.Conclusion For the same absorbed dose, the VFS irradiation protocol, especially the protocol with decreasing fraction sizes can prolong the ASP of mice, so perhaps this kind of protocol can be used in clinics to improve the effect in radiotherapy.
